Mumbai: In a shocking incident in Kalbadevi, Mumbai, a 55-year-old man died during a same-sex encounter. The Lokmanya Tilak (LT) Marg police arrested his 34-year-old partner on March 17, charging him with negligence leading to death. The incident reportedly occurred in February.
According to the police, the deceased became unconscious during the encounter. However, instead of seeking medical help, his partner fled the scene, leaving him unattended. The man was later found dead.

During the investigation, the police discovered that the accused had also stolen the deceased's mobile phone before fleeing. Both the accused’s and the victim’s phones were later seized by the police as part of the investigation. The LT Marg police have booked the accused for negligence causing death and are continuing the probe into the incident.
